Enzymes alone do not “clean” surgical instruments. Surgical Instrument Detergents are necessary. Surgical Instrument Detergents are necessary to clean the surface of surgical instruments once enzymes have broken down bioburden. It is commonly stated that enzymes “clean rapidly”. Enzymes alone do not “clean”. The primary function of an enzyme surgical instrument detergent cleaner is to break down soil, usually proteinaceous bioburden. For a surgical instrument detergent cleaning product to “clean”, surfactant detergents are necessary that will remove the soil from the surface of the surgical instruments. A combination of enzymes and detergents are necessary for optimal cleaning. The use of enzymes of various compositions and concentrations, in enzyme surgical instrument detergent cleaners is becoming common. Over half of all surgical instrument detergents presently available contain some level of enzyme detergent. If designed properly, surgical instrument detergent enzyme cleaners can: remove proteinaceous bioburden from surgical instruments, dissolve mineral encrustation from surgical instruments, remove stains from surgical instruments, and enhance the “passive layer” of the surgical instrument stainless steel and lubricate surgical instruments
